Integrating Typography with Romantic Vectors
A beautiful illustration is only half the battle. The success of your design relies heavily on how you pair it with typography. Since C3683 is described as a "contemporary" and "modern interpretation," it requires a font pairing strategy that complements rather than competes.
Avoid using overly ornate or hard-to-read script fonts for the main body text. While a flowing script font might look great next to the couple for a headline like "Sarah & James," it will fail miserably for details like "Reception to follow at 6 PM." Instead, opt for a clean serif font (like a modern Didone) or a geometric sans serif font. The contrast between the intricate, organic lines of the vector art and the structured geometry of a sans serif creates a beautiful tension that feels professional.
Readability considerations are paramount here. If you are using the vector as a background element with low opacity, ensure your text has high contrast. If you are using it as a standalone focal point, give it breathing room. Don't crowd the "enchanting accents" with too much information. Let the graphic do the emotional heavy lifting while your typography handles the logistics.
